I came here specifically for a few cannolis and left with so much more! It was my first time visiting this Italian bakery on Brady Street and I found it to have an excellent assortment of baked goods including Italian cookies sold by the pound, fresh breads made daily, donuts and croissants, cheesecakes and also unexpected goodies too like big, soft Bavarian style pretzels (for under $5), cornbread muffins and savory spinach and feta pastries. Prices were all very reasonable especially for the cannolis which were made to order. That's right! Don't panic like I did when I didn't see pre-made cannolis sitting behind a bakery case and figured they were all sold out by the time I arrived at 1pm on a weekday (ha!) When you ask for cannolis, you get to choose either plan or chocolate converted shells - I did a few of each. Each cannoli was less than $4 and a delicious / rare treat. I really enjoyed perusing all the delicious treats here and will be back to try more. So far I can highly recommend the cheesecake, cannolis, cherry turnovers and spinach & feta pastry. If you're into fresh bread they do have a punch card where you get a free loaf after you buy 12 loaves. I'll also mention that the customer service was a breath of fresh air. The woman who helped me was kind, knowledgeable and greeted me the moment I walked in. There is no inside seating. This is a grab and go place. As for parking, this is a busy part of the city so be prepared to circle the block a time or two to find a parking spot. I had some luck finding parking on a nearby side street (for free) and then just walked over. If you plan to come here during the weekend I imagine parking will be even more difficult to find - depending on the time of day you stop by.
